Article : Assembly Linker (Al.exe .Net FrameWork Tools Series)
Hi All,
Assembly linker is a tool which is used to create an assembly by combining
one or more .netmodules and resource files.
In simple words an .netmodule is an IL file that does not have manifest in
it .... you can say its an assembly without the manifest ... and hence a
non -assembly file containing IL code.
In the yesterday's example we saw how we can create the .resources file
which by itself is a binary file containing your resource data. Today we
will see how we can embed or link this .resource file with other .netmodules
and create an assembly
1) Create 2 .netmodules say Module1.netmodule and Module2.netmodule
2) Create a .resources file say MyResources.resources (as we created in
yesterdays article ... please to the same for more details)
3) Now type the follwoing command to combine these modules and binary
resource file into a single assembly.
// to create a dll.
al Module1.netmodule Module2.netmodule /embed:MyResources.resources
/out:MyExecutable.dll
// to create an exe.
al Module1.netmodule Module2.netmodule /embed:MyResources.resources
/out:MyExecutable.exe /target:exe /Main:Class1.Main
If you dont want to embed the resource file then use the /link option
instead of /embed option with al.exe.
Well if you have an want to embed or link a resource then you can compile
the resource file when you are compliing the assembly with csc.exe or
vbc.exe just use /resource to embed the resource or /linkresource with the
assembly.
You can also achieve this from VS.Net studio by including the resource file
in the project and setting the Build Action of the resource type to Embedded
Resource.
Al is mainly used by a lot of developers to create resource satellite
assemblies esp for creating multilingual applications by creating resource
assemblies for various cultures.
If only resource files are passed to Al.exe, the output file is a satellite
resource assembly.
E.g. To create an satellite assembly for french culture
1) Create a file named MyResource.fr-FR.txt
2) Type your name=value resource data in it to generate the resource file
3) generate the resource file with the name of MyResource.fr-FR.resources.
4) And finally create the satellite assembly as shown below for your
application
al /out:MyGlobApp.resources.dll /v:1.0.0.0/c:fr-FR
/embed:MyResource.fr-FR.resources, Private
Note : Check out the Private keyword in the above command. You can use the
"private" option if you want dont want other assemblies to use the embedded
resource files by default it is "public".
5) In this command we have specified the output file name , the version of
this DLL , the culture "fr-FR" which denotes french and finally we are
embedding the fr-FR.resources file in MyGlobApp.resources.dll
6) Place this file in bin\fr-FR folder of your application and read it from
the application using the ResourceManger Class.
There are a lot of other options that are available with AL you can view
these options by typing al /? or al /help. I am enlisting a few important or
frequently used ones here :
a.. /copy[right]:<text> Copyright message
b.. /c[ulture]:<text> Supported culture
c.. /delay[sign][+|-] Delay sign this assembly
d.. /out:<filename> Output file name for the assembly
manifest
e.. /t[arget]:lib[rary] Create a library
f.. /t[arget]:exe Create a console executable
g.. /t[arget]:win[exe] Create a Windows executable
h.. /trade[mark]:<text> Trademark message
i.. /v[ersion]:<version> Version (use * to auto-generate remaining
numbers)
j.. /win32icon:<filename> Use this icon for the output
k.. /win32res:<filename> Specifies the Win32 resource file
If you checkout the help at the end you will see this lines which show you
how to go about using this tool.
Sources: (at least one source input is required) <filename>[,<targetfile>]
add file to assembly
/embed[resource]:<filename>[,<name>[,Private]]
embed the file as a resource in the assembly
/link[resource]:<filename>[,<name>[,<targetfile>[,Private]]]
link the file as a resource to the assembly

Hi All,
This is a resource file generation tool which converts an xml based =
resource formats to .net resource file i.e. (.resources) and vice-versa. =
Today we will see how we will generate
=3D=3D> .txt files from .resources or .resx files.=20
=3D=3D> .resources files from text or .resx files.=20
=3D=3D> .resx files from text or .resources files.=20
Let us start with converting a .txt file to resources or resx file=20
In order to convert from one type to another we must ensure that the =
data written in them is in the correct format.=20
Text files can only contain string resources as name=3Dvalue pairs. Name =
here is a string that describes the resource it needs to be=20
unique and the value is the resource string. All these name value pairs =
should start from a new line.=20
Lets create a text file containing 10 name=3Dvalue pairs;=20
1) Create a text file name MyText.txt.
2) Type the below name=3Dvalue pairs=20
name1=3Dvalue
name2=3Dvalue
name3=3Dvalue
name4=3Dvalue
name5=3Dvalue
name6=3Dvalue
name7=3Dvalue
name8=3Dvalue
name9=3Dvalue
name10=3Dvalue=20
3) Type the following command to generate MyResources.resx from =
MyText.txt.=20
4) If you duplicated any of the entires you will get the below error =
message.=20
error: Duplicate resource key!
Else your resources will be complied successfully with the following =
message.
Read in 10 resources from 'MyText.txt'
Writing resource file... Done.=20
5) To generate .resources file from .txt file use the following command =
resgen MyText.txt MyResources.resources=20
6) To genereate .txt from .resources file or .resx file use the =
following commands
resgen MyResources.resx MyTextFromRes.txt
resgen MyResources.resources MyTextFromResources.txt=20
7) To generate .txt file from resx file or .resource file use the =
following commands:=20
resgen MyResources.resx MyTextFromRes.txt
resgen MyResources.resources MyTextFromResources.txt=20
There are a certain advantages or disadvantages of these format over one =
another :=20
1) Text file format name=3Dvalue pair is very convient ,easy to use and =
create but can contain only text strings and hence you cannot embed any =
objects in these files.
2) Resx file format has the data in the xml format and hence you can =
embed objects. You will also be able to view the binary information =
about these objects e.g. embedding images in the resource files.=20
Thus
.Resources file is a binary file which is used by the assemblies
.Resx has the data in an xml format
.txt has the data in name=3Dvalue format .... gr8 so many ways to =
represent and use your data.=20
To use these resource files in your assembly( as a part of your =
assembly) you will need to embed or link it with main assembly using =
assembly linker or create satellite assembly.(We will look into detail =
about this in tommorrow's article).
